Nintendo and Pokémon Co. have put out their own remakes of classic Pokémon titles, but sometimes that’s just not enough for fans. One fan in particular wanted to see Pokémon Yellow get the remake treatment, and they had a very specific vision for it.

YouTuber Pokebro has been working on a remake of Pokémon Yellow in 3D, and they’re using the remake of The Legend of Zelda: Link’s Awakening as a point of reference. Pokebro’s approach is decidedly more pixel/voxel-heavy, but you can definitely see the influence in the development video above.

If you’re impressed by what you see, you might be surprised to know that all of this came together in just two weeks time. While there’s still a long way to go, this early start is quite promising. Of course, the biggest hurdle for this remake will be escaping the Nintendo ninjas who’ll no doubt squash this project if it sees release. For now, we can just watch development move along and enjoy from afar.
